Angler Beast Solitary, Huge, Stealthy, Terrifying Bite (d10+5 damage 1 piercing) 24 HP 1 armor Reach Special Qualities: Hideously Ugly Like an Angler Fish, only large enough to swallow an adventurer whole, and with four stubby little legs instead of fins. Most have luminous lures, hiding behind doors or around corners, hoping the bobbing and dancing lights will lure curious prey to it. Some instead have lures that appear as precious gemstones or even ornate treasure chests, hiding the bulk of their body in rubble or rubbish until someone draws close enough for a surprisingly swift strike. Instinct: To wait, and feed
- Swallow someone whole
- Lure someone in while lurking, camouflaged

Servant Of The Nameless Gods Group, Divine, Magical, Organized, Intelligent, Planar Incomprehensible Strike (d10+2 damage) 12 HP 1 armor Close The Nameless Gods created their servants as living extensions of their will, tools to manipulate the world which they had created, abstract concepts wrapped in a crude and imperfect shell of concrete existence. The Nameless Gods themselves are dead, slain by the pantheon that currently rules over modern civilization, but echoes and shadows of their will and power remain, and it is these bitter and spiteful vestiges that their former servants still obey. When you gaze upon a Servant Of The Nameless Gods for the first time, your mind cannot comprehend what it sees. Tell the GM what your mind forces you to see it as instead, or choose one: * Two floating, interlocked wheels, covered in eyes * A beautiful androgynous humanoid figure, with six iridescent wings, and a sword which vibrates to strange harmonies * A pillar of fire, of a color never before seen in this world. (Each Servant is an incarnation of the DW GM Moves, as each of the Nameless God is/was the embodiment of one of the GM Principles.) Instinct: To serve the memories of the Nameless Gods
- (use its defining move)
- Disturb the fabric of reality
- Unleash a strange cry, summoning others of its kind
- Phase in or out of reality, avoiding a blow or striking from an unguarded angle

Cursed Spirit Solitary, Magical, Intelligent, Amorphous Claws (d10 damage 1 piercing) 19 HP Close, Reach, Ignores Armor Special Qualities: Cannot be harmed by physical attacks, Able to silence spellcasters The Cursed Spirit wanders graveyards and crypts, attacking those who disturb it. The reasons for why the spirit is cursed is known only to the spirit. In life perhaps it was an unfaithful lover, a cowardly soldier who fled from battle, or an unscrupulous merchant who wronged the wrong people. Perhaps learning of how it met this horrible fate could shed light on how to ease its eternal rest? Instinct: To bring pain and torment to the living
- Non-corporeal, so common blades cannot harm it
- Silent Shriek - silences spellcasters
